Abstract

The study area occupies the southwestern part of Najaf Governorate, most of whose surface is covered by alluvial soil of the type of sedimentary soil, which is characterized by a general slope from north to south. As well as the difference in their properties. They are: (location, geological composition, surface, climate with its elements (solar radiation, temperature, wind, relative humidity, precipitation, evaporation), soil with its natural and chemical characteristics, and natural vegetation). The surface determines the course of the geographical extensions of the irrigation and drainage network system in the study area, as it takes a direction (north-south-east-west).
